xlwings调用excel函数
相关视频/文章
相关问答
如何在Excel里调用python自定义函数?在VBA里调用python代码?_百度知...

在xlwings选项卡中配置参数,包括Python.exe的路径、Python文件的路径和文件名。记得在信任中心的宏设置中勾选“信任对VBA工程对象模型的访问”选项,以避免错误。点击Import Functions,即可在Excel单元格中使用自定义Python函数。而在VBA编辑器中,通过工具--引用菜单,选择xlwings进行引用,然后在VBA代码中...

Python操作Excel的Xlwings教程(二)

1. Apps与工作簿实例创建工作簿实例时,可以通过wx.App(visible=False)参数来避免默认显示在桌面。通过Active方法,可以激活指定的工作簿进行操作,如App.Active。2. APP与Book对象要查找所有打开的Book对象,可以使用Books()方法。xw.Book()会新建工作簿并打开Excel,而xw.books则不会打开新窗口。引用工...

如何在Excel里调用python自定义函数?在VBA里调用python代码?_百度知...

(1)打开Anaconda Prompt,输入以下命令并按回车键:conda install -c conda-forge xlwings (2)安装完成后,电脑上会生成一个名为“xlwings.xlam”的文件。使用Windows文件搜索功能,查找该文件的具体地址。(3)调出Excel开发工具选项卡。(4)在开发工具选项卡界面点击“Excel加载项”功能,在弹出的“...

python的xlwings,如何实现弹窗交互选择Excel某单元格,并返回该单元格位...

data=xlrd.open_workbook(你要读取的文档的路劲+文档名)table=data.sheets()[0]:表示xls文件的第一个表格,[1]表示第二个表格 cell=table.cell(行,列).value #读取特定行特定列的内容

【办公自动化】用python的xlwings秒完excel工作喂饭级系列---批量创建...

首先,使用xlwings库实现批量创建工作表的方法如下:代码示例一:import xlwings as xw file_path = 'd:\\财务'app = xw.App(visible=True, add_book=False)wb = app.books.add()wb.save(file_path + '\\同事小张.xlsx')sheetName = ['部门', '公司', '集团']for i in sheetName:wb....

【办公自动化】用python的xlwings秒完excel工作喂饭级系列--批量修改...

首先,我们需要导入xlwings库并指定要操作的文件位置。通过os库查找文件列表,然后使用xlwings创建Excel程序实例来操作文件。接下来,我们将实现一系列代码,对标题、表头以及数据行进行格式调整。具体操作如下:1. 设定标题文字样式,包括字体、大小和颜色,同时输入标题内容。2. 调整表头文字样式,包括字体、...

2019-12-13 (一)使用Xlwings从Excel,取数至Pandas的DataFrame和Series...

same3 """我们通过Xlwings 调用 Excel特定区域的数据集,将用来测试Panda对于None值/NaN/null/空值(以下统称空值)的处理,本次我们将会学到:对含有空值的DataFrame进行各种选择操作,以及对空值数据的填充fillna()、删除dropna(),我们将在后面陆续介绍。笔者是技术进步的拥趸,Python 的IDE:Spyder,从...

【办公自动化】用python的xlwings秒完excel工作喂饭级系列--批量修改...

导入必要的库和定义文件路径,接下来遍历文件列表,使用xlwings打开每个报表文件,定位到A2以下的数据区域,并设置字体名称和大小。接着,我们写入一行数据,确保格式正确。以下是实现代码的详细步骤和解释:导入os库用于文件路径定位,导入xlwings库用于Excel文件操作。定义文件路径,查找文件列表,并创建Excel程序...

经典!Python中使用xlrd与xlwt操作Excel文件详解

首先,通过xlrd.open_workbook加载文件,然后使用sheet_names和sheet_by_index/sheet_by_name选取工作表,通过nrows/ncols获取行列数,row_values/col_values获取指定行列数据,行或列操作则可通过循环实现,而cell则用于获取单元格值。xlwt:写入Excel内容xlwt主要用于新建文件,通过Workbook和add_sheet/save...

Excel中使用python的xlwings模块代替VBA的使用问题

其他的我不懂,但是WB.sheets(0).range("A1").value="hello world!",这句,sheets的index可以是表格名称(文本),可以是1到n的序号,0如果是表格名称需要“0”引号标记